TRUMP ADMINISTRATION SOUTH SUDAN DEPORTATION ATTEMPT VIOLATED COURT ORDER, JUDGE SAYS

President Donald Trump's attempt to transfer immigrants to South Sudan was "unquestionably violative" of a judicial order not to deport migrants to countries other than their own without opportunity to contest their deportations, a U.S. judge said on Wednesday.

Boston-based U.S. District Judge Brian Murphy made the finding during a hearing one day after he ordered the administration not to let a group of migrants being flown to South Sudan to leave the custody of U.S. immigration authorities. The judge said the migrants appeared to have been deported in violation of his previous order.
